Output 64c93796e9913146f12ef2f4025284c7cd4a8a7b896b816cabcf8274dcfe7f68:0

value
530606805
script pubkey
OP_0 OP_PUSHBYTES_20 37b6305da3bcafccd0d717cefa29abd74327f83b
address
ltc1qx7mrqhdrhjhue5xhzl8052dt6apj07pmsz7c7f
transaction
64c93796e9913146f12ef2f4025284c7cd4a8a7b896b816cabcf8274dcfe7f68
spent
true